Risposte nei forum create
-
AutorePost
-
sergejpinkaPartecipante
mi sto scervellando ma non mi rierisce compiacciare nulla.
sergejpinkaPartecipanteGrazie l’ho beccato 10 minuti dopo che avevo scritto in questo forum ;-P
sergejpinkaPartecipanteNo, visto che c’è un filtro sull’output come ben indicato nelal documentazione si scrive una funzione che filtri l’output e aggiunga quelche serve… poi mi spieghi a cosa serve il title in quel link …
Ok, il title in un link viene utilizzato, fra le altre cose, per una migliore indicizzazione e un miglior rispetto della sintassi HTML.
Detto questo, penso che t ti riferisca alla riga contenente:
@uses apply_filters() Calls ‘register’ hook on register / admin link content.
non ci avevo fatto caso (è da poco che lavoro su WP ad un livello cosଠprofondo backand).
Poi, ho trovato qualche doumento, lo metto qui (se fosse poco interessante postatene altri nei commenti): Function Reference/apply filters, Usiamo i filtri per i childe Theme di WordPress, PHP Guida in italiano (in PDF).
sergejpinkaPartecipanteNel wp-includes/general-template.php, è presente il codice:
/**
* Display the Registration or Admin link.
*
* Display a link which allows the user to navigate to the registration page if
* not logged in and registration is enabled or to the dashboard if logged in.
*
* @since 1.5.0
* @uses apply_filters() Calls 'register' hook on register / admin link content.
*
* @param string $before Text to output before the link (defaults to
- ).
* @param string $after Text to output after the link (defaults to
).
* @param boolean $echo Default to echo and not return the link.
*/
function wp_register( $before = '
- ', $after = '
', $echo = true ) {
if ( ! is_user_logged_in() ) {
if ( get_option('users_can_register') )
$link = $before . '' . __('Register') . '' . $after;
else
$link = '';
} else {
$link = $before . '' . __('Site Admin') . '' . $after;
}
if ( $echo )
echo apply_filters('register', $link);
else
return apply_filters('register', $link);
}
la riga che "crea" l'output HTML è quella con il codice:
$link = $before . '' . __('Register') . '' . $after;
assieme alla riga
$link = $before . '' . __('Site Admin') . '' . $after;
Queste due righe andrebbero modificate in:
$link = $before . ' title="Register"' . __('Register') . '' . $after;
ed anche
$link = $before . '' . __('Site Admin') . '' . $after;
Secondo voi è opportuna tale modifica?
sergejpinkaPartecipanteOk, ho trovato il codice.
<!--@@@ INIZIO CODICE @@@-->
<?php if ( $user_ID ) : ?>
<?php wp_head();
global $user_identity;
?>
<div id="loginHeaderLoggato">
<p><span style="font-weight:bold">Salve</span>, /wp-admin/profile.php"><?php echo $user_identity; ?>. " title="Log out of this account">Log Out</p>
</div>
<?php else : ?>
<div id="loginHeaderForm">
<form name="loginform" id="loginform" action="<?php echo get_option('siteurl'); ?>/wp-login.php" method="post">
Username <input value="Username" class="input" type="text" size="20" tabindex="10" name="log" id="user_login" onfocus="if (this.value == 'Username') {this.value = '';}" onblur="if (this.value == '') {this.value = 'Username';}" />
Password <input value="Password" class="input" type="password" size="20" tabindex="20" name="pwd" id="user_pass" onfocus="if (this.value == 'Password') {this.value = '';}" onblur="if (this.value == '') {this.value = 'Password';}" />
<input name="rememberme" id="rememberme" value="forever" tabindex="90" type="checkbox"> Remember Me?
<input name="wp-submit" id="wp-submit" value="Log In" tabindex="100" type="submit">
<input name="redirect_to" value="<?php echo get_option('siteurl'); ?>/wp-admin/" type="hidden">
<input name="testcookie" value="1" type="hidden">
</form>
- <?php wp_register(); ?>
</div>
<?php endif; ?>
<!--@@@ FINE CODICE @@@-->
Per vedere l'output: http://www.cucinoperavsi.it.
Funziona bene.
Se qualcuno avesse una idea per migliorarlo ben venga.
sergejpinkaPartecipanteAvrei trovato questo articolo: How to submit blog posts from WordPress to Facebook automatically ma è in inglese e sinceramente non son riuscito a capire tutti i passaggi.
Se qualcuno riuscisse a scrivere un articolo su questo, in italiano, magari traducendo l’articolo suddetto penso farebbe la gioia di molti.
sergejpinkaPartecipanteok risolto ho aumentato lo spazio in tophost.
sergejpinkaPartecipantealtro errore…:
Scaricamento aggiornamento da http://downloads.wordpress.org/plugin/akismet.2.4.0.zip…
Warning: touch() [function.touch]: Unable to create file /home/mhd-01/www.sergejpinka.it/htdocs/wp-content/akismet.tmp because Disk quota exceeded in /home/mhd-01/www.sergejpinka.it/htdocs/wp-admin/includes/file.php on line 199
Download fallito. Impossibile creare il file temporaneo
…idee?
sergejpinkaPartecipanteaumentare lo spazio del db? apri un ticket con top host che ti spiegano cosa fare
perchè dovrei aprire un ticket? non puoi spiegarlo qui? …forse non sono l’unico che ha questo problema…
Comunque, si, il mio DB di Tophost sta eccedendo di 4598 KB…. :-!
Wolly aiutami! O_O’
sergejpinkaPartecipanteNo non esiste… se il codice è nei temi lo modifichi se è nei post, devi lavorare di query SQL, il motivo di fare sta cosa?
ci son riuscito. E’ possibile modificare un qualsiasi codice in uno o più post già scritti, mediante il plugin: Search & Replace.
Con quel plugin son riuscito ad apportare modifiche a tutti i miei vecchi post, modificando il codice da
<p align=”right”>
a
<p class=”right”>
- ).
-
AutorePost